Parliament Adopts Statement on the Armed Attack of Azerbaijan

At September 13 sitting, the RA National Assembly discussed and adopted the NA Draft Statement “The Statement of the National Assembly of the Republic of Armenia on the Armed Attack of Azerbaijan” authored by the NA President Alen Simonyan, the NA Vice President Ruben Rubinyan and the deputy Vladimir Vardanyan.

The NA President Alen Simonyan informed the parliament that, in accordance with Article 98 of the constitutional law NA Rules of Procedure, he presented the NA Draft Statement on the Armed Attack of Azerbaijan.

The Chair of the Standing Committee on State and Legal Affairs, the co-author of the NA Statement Vladimir Vardanyan presented the NA Draft Statement.

The deputy of the Civil Contract Faction Arpine Davoyan inquired of the proposals of the NA opposition factions were included in the NA Statement.

In response to that, Vladimir Vardanyan informed that beginning from 09:40 the Civil Contract Faction worked with the NA With Honor and Armenia Factions, who presented packages of certain proposals.

The proposals of the Armenia Faction directly did not refer to the aggressive actions unleashed yesterday. Part of the proposals of With Honor Faction referred to the situation created on some part, and we were ready to partially take into consideration those proposals in the mentioned Statement. I would like to distinctly note that it was important for us to have unity between the parliamentary factions in the hall today. Unfortunately, it failed,” Vladimir Vardanyan said.

The deputy informed that part of the opposition colleagues’ proposals was inadmissible, that is why their proposals were not included in NA Statement.

Presenting the viewpoint of the NA Armenia Faction, Artsvik Minasyan noted that they are not against the Statement, but in their opinion, it is not complete and does not contain any solution. “If we were not intended on the defense of our statehood, we would not say these most important provisions,” he noted and informed that in this situation the Armenia Faction will not take part in voting.

On behalf of the RA NA Civil Contract Faction the RA NA President Alen Simonyan delivered a speech.

As a result of the discussions, with 65 votes for the parliament adopted the Statement.

The National Assembly will continue the work of the regular sitting on September 14, at 10:00.
